What is it about?
How hepatic mitochondria become dysfunctional during nonalcoholic fatty liver disease/steatohepatitis (NAFLD/NASH) development is unknown. We show that hepatocyte-specific endothelial nitric oxide synthase is a vital regulator of NAFLD/NASH susceptibility by maintaining a healthy mitochondrial pool within the liver with clinical relevance to patients.
